Team augmentation

What is Team Augmentation?

Team augmentation refers to bolstering an in-house team by incorporating specialized members from external sources. This arrangement empowers businesses to retain control and transparency while gaining access to the crucial skills and expertise required for swift advancement.


When Team Augmentation is Useful?

Team augmentation can be especially useful for various business needs, including:


Skill Gaps

When there are specific skill gaps within an existing team, team augmentation allows businesses to bring in specialists who possess the required expertise to fill those gaps. This is particularly beneficial when the skills needed are niche or temporary in nature.



During periods of increased workload or when undertaking new projects, team augmentation enables businesses to quickly scale up their workforce without the need for extensive hiring processes. It provides the flexibility to add additional resources on demand to meet the increased demands.


Time-Sensitive Projects

For time-sensitive projects with strict deadlines, augmenting the team with specialists can expedite the project timeline. These experts bring their experience and efficiency to ensure the timely completion of critical tasks.


Cost Optimization

Team augmentation allows businesses to optimize costs by avoiding long-term commitments associated with permanent hires. Instead of investing in recruiting, onboarding, and training new employees, companies can tap into the skills of external specialists as and when needed.


Knowledge Enhancement

Augmenting the team with external specialists brings in fresh perspectives, industry insights, and specialized knowledge. This collaboration enhances the overall knowledge base within the organization, promoting innovation and growth.


Access to Technology and Tools

In rapidly evolving technological landscapes, team augmentation enables businesses to access the latest tools and technologies through specialized team members. This ensures that the organization stays competitive and can leverage the most efficient and effective solutions.

Overall, team augmentation is particularly useful for addressing skill gaps, achieving scalability, meeting time-sensitive project requirements, optimizing costs, enhancing knowledge, and accessing advanced technology and tools. It provides businesses with the agility and flexibility to adapt to changing needs while leveraging external expertise to achieve their goals.

Importance of Team Augmentation

Team augmentation is an increasingly popular outsourcing strategy that offers flexibility in hiring new IT team members. It addresses the current business environment, especially during the COVID-19 pandemic, where companies have realized that physical co-location is not necessary for achieving desired results.

Recruiting highly qualified tech team members has become challenging due to limited talent pools and increasing payroll costs. The evolving IT landscape, with changing programming languages, complex tech stacks, and niche applications, adds to the recruitment difficulties. Many companies struggle to find professionals with specific skills within their home country. The demand for tech professionals is rising due to the digitalization of the economy, but the supply of candidates is not keeping pace. This leads to increased costs for hiring IT experts. Companies from abroad often turn to team augmentation services to reduce one of their core operational costs. Hiring IT professionals independently comes with challenges, making it beneficial to seek assistance from specialists in staff augmentation. Team extension allows companies to hire tech talent from outside their home market and manage the extended team directly. While clients can be involved in the recruitment process, it is recommended to focus on the final stages to ensure the selection of the best-matching candidates. IT team extension providers help companies add highly skilled tech team members, often with specific and niche knowledge, to their in-house development teams. These resources are employed by the supplier, relieving the organizational and administrative burdens. Staff augmentation takes various forms, but a dedicated team approach is preferred, ensuring maximum benefits for clients.



It’s important to highlight a few key points about team augmentation. Firstly, it differs from outsourcing an entire project, as it involves enhancing your existing core staff with remote developers possessing the specific skills and expertise you require.

Secondly, team augmentation can serve as a short-term solution or a means to assemble individuals who will collaborate for an extended period. If you need assistance in getting a project back on track or require temporary developers, staff augmentation services are the ideal choice.

Additionally, if you require a dedicated team to support your in-house team in managing multiple projects simultaneously, team augmentation services should be considered.

Lastly, the essence of staff augmentation lies in collaboration. The objective is to bring together individuals with complementary skills who can work collaboratively toward achieving a shared goal.

